English Language Versions

KJV   Then the Philistines went up, and pitched in Judah, and spread themselves in Lehi.
KJVP   Then the Philistines H6430 went up, H5927 and pitched H2583 in Judah, H3063 and spread themselves H5203 in Lehi. H3896
YLT   And the Philistines go up, and encamp in Judah, and are spread out in Lehi,
ASV   Then the Philistines went up, and encamped in Judah, and spread themselves in Lehi.
WEB   Then the Philistines went up, and encamped in Judah, and spread themselves in Lehi.
RV   Then the Philistines went up, and pitched in Judah, and spread themselves in Lehi.
NET   The Philistines went up and invaded Judah. They arrayed themselves for battle in Lehi.
ERVEN   The Philistines went to the land of Judah and stopped near a place named Lehi. Their army camped there.
